Toilet Clearing in Columbus, OH
Toilet clearing services involve the removal of blockages and obstructions that prevent toilets from functioning properly. These services typically address issues such as clogs caused by excessive toilet paper, foreign objects, or buildup within the pipes. Projects can range from resolving minor blockages to more complex situations involving sewer line backups or damaged plumbing components. Property owners often request toilet clearing when toilets are slow to drain, overflow, or refuse to flush, aiming to restore normal operation and prevent further plumbing problems.
Before requesting toilet clearing services, homeowners should consider providing details about the nature of the problem, including when the issue began and any recent changes or incidents that may have contributed. It’s helpful to know if the blockage is isolated to a single toilet or affects multiple fixtures, as well as any previous plumbing repairs or issues. Clarifying these details can assist in determining the appropriate approach and ensuring the service addresses the root cause of the problem effectively.

Toilet Clearing Questions
What causes toilet clogs? Common causes include excess toilet paper, foreign objects, or buildup in the pipes that block flow.
How can I prevent toilet blockages? Avoid flushing non-flushable items and limit the amount of toilet paper used at once.
What are signs of a clogged toilet? Slow drainage, frequent backups, or gurgling sounds indicate a blockage.
When is professional clearing needed? If the toilet remains clogged after using a plunger or if backups occur frequently, professional clearing may be necessary.
